An older british comic entitled the hammer man featured a spectacularly strong medieval blacksmith called chel puddock who, over the course of the series, defeated knights, was himself knighted, led rebellions against corrupt barons and eventually rose to be a lord. Although historically they shared the same format size, based on a sheet of 30 x 22 inch imperial paper, folded, british comics have moved away from this size, adopting a standard magazine size. An overview of the history of british comics by mike kidson, reproduced with his kind permission the british weekly comic as we know and love it emerged in the 1890s as part of a boom in cheap, popular magazine and newspaper publishing which resulted directly from the provision of basic education for all that had been initiated by the governments education act of 1870.
